Skip to content

Commit 8a73735

Browse files
test(NODE-5300): add 7.0 to CI (#3676)
1 parent 98b7bdf commit 8a73735

File tree

2 files changed

+109
-1
lines changed

2 files changed

+109
-1
lines changed

.evergreen/ci_matrix_constants.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
const MONGODB_VERSIONS = ['latest', 'rapid', '6.0', '5.0', '4.4', '4.2', '4.0', '3.6'];
1+
const MONGODB_VERSIONS = ['latest', 'rapid', '7.0', '6.0', '5.0', '4.4', '4.2', '4.0', '3.6'];
22
const versions = [
33
{ codeName: 'erbium', versionNumber: 12 },
44
{ codeName: 'fermium', versionNumber: 14 },

.evergreen/config.yml

Lines changed: 108 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1062,6 +1062,45 @@ tasks:
10621062
AUTH: auth
10631063
- func: bootstrap kms servers
10641064
- func: run tests
1065+
- name: test-7.0-server
1066+
tags:
1067+
- '7.0'
1068+
- server
1069+
commands:
1070+
- func: install dependencies
1071+
- func: bootstrap mongo-orchestration
1072+
vars:
1073+
VERSION: '7.0'
1074+
TOPOLOGY: server
1075+
AUTH: auth
1076+
- func: bootstrap kms servers
1077+
- func: run tests
1078+
- name: test-7.0-replica_set
1079+
tags:
1080+
- '7.0'
1081+
- replica_set
1082+
commands:
1083+
- func: install dependencies
1084+
- func: bootstrap mongo-orchestration
1085+
vars:
1086+
VERSION: '7.0'
1087+
TOPOLOGY: replica_set
1088+
AUTH: auth
1089+
- func: bootstrap kms servers
1090+
- func: run tests
1091+
- name: test-7.0-sharded_cluster
1092+
tags:
1093+
- '7.0'
1094+
- sharded_cluster
1095+
commands:
1096+
- func: install dependencies
1097+
- func: bootstrap mongo-orchestration
1098+
vars:
1099+
VERSION: '7.0'
1100+
TOPOLOGY: sharded_cluster
1101+
AUTH: auth
1102+
- func: bootstrap kms servers
1103+
- func: run tests
10651104
- name: test-6.0-server
10661105
tags:
10671106
- '6.0'
@@ -2608,6 +2647,48 @@ tasks:
26082647
AUTH: noauth
26092648
- func: bootstrap kms servers
26102649
- func: run tests
2650+
- name: test-7.0-server-noauth
2651+
tags:
2652+
- '7.0'
2653+
- server
2654+
- noauth
2655+
commands:
2656+
- func: install dependencies
2657+
- func: bootstrap mongo-orchestration
2658+
vars:
2659+
VERSION: '7.0'
2660+
TOPOLOGY: server
2661+
AUTH: noauth
2662+
- func: bootstrap kms servers
2663+
- func: run tests
2664+
- name: test-7.0-replica_set-noauth
2665+
tags:
2666+
- '7.0'
2667+
- replica_set
2668+
- noauth
2669+
commands:
2670+
- func: install dependencies
2671+
- func: bootstrap mongo-orchestration
2672+
vars:
2673+
VERSION: '7.0'
2674+
TOPOLOGY: replica_set
2675+
AUTH: noauth
2676+
- func: bootstrap kms servers
2677+
- func: run tests
2678+
- name: test-7.0-sharded_cluster-noauth
2679+
tags:
2680+
- '7.0'
2681+
- sharded_cluster
2682+
- noauth
2683+
commands:
2684+
- func: install dependencies
2685+
- func: bootstrap mongo-orchestration
2686+
vars:
2687+
VERSION: '7.0'
2688+
TOPOLOGY: sharded_cluster
2689+
AUTH: noauth
2690+
- func: bootstrap kms servers
2691+
- func: run tests
26112692
- name: test-6.0-server-noauth
26122693
tags:
26132694
- '6.0'
@@ -3043,6 +3124,9 @@ buildvariants:
30433124
- test-rapid-server
30443125
- test-rapid-replica_set
30453126
- test-rapid-sharded_cluster
3127+
- test-7.0-server
3128+
- test-7.0-replica_set
3129+
- test-7.0-sharded_cluster
30463130
- test-6.0-server
30473131
- test-6.0-replica_set
30483132
- test-6.0-sharded_cluster
@@ -3091,6 +3175,9 @@ buildvariants:
30913175
- test-rapid-server
30923176
- test-rapid-replica_set
30933177
- test-rapid-sharded_cluster
3178+
- test-7.0-server
3179+
- test-7.0-replica_set
3180+
- test-7.0-sharded_cluster
30943181
- test-6.0-server
30953182
- test-6.0-replica_set
30963183
- test-6.0-sharded_cluster
@@ -3139,6 +3226,9 @@ buildvariants:
31393226
- test-rapid-server
31403227
- test-rapid-replica_set
31413228
- test-rapid-sharded_cluster
3229+
- test-7.0-server
3230+
- test-7.0-replica_set
3231+
- test-7.0-sharded_cluster
31423232
- test-6.0-server
31433233
- test-6.0-replica_set
31443234
- test-6.0-sharded_cluster
@@ -3185,6 +3275,9 @@ buildvariants:
31853275
- test-rapid-server
31863276
- test-rapid-replica_set
31873277
- test-rapid-sharded_cluster
3278+
- test-7.0-server
3279+
- test-7.0-replica_set
3280+
- test-7.0-sharded_cluster
31883281
- test-6.0-server
31893282
- test-6.0-replica_set
31903283
- test-6.0-sharded_cluster
@@ -3277,6 +3370,9 @@ buildvariants:
32773370
- test-rapid-server
32783371
- test-rapid-replica_set
32793372
- test-rapid-sharded_cluster
3373+
- test-7.0-server
3374+
- test-7.0-replica_set
3375+
- test-7.0-sharded_cluster
32803376
- test-6.0-server
32813377
- test-6.0-replica_set
32823378
- test-6.0-sharded_cluster
@@ -3320,6 +3416,9 @@ buildvariants:
33203416
- test-rapid-server
33213417
- test-rapid-replica_set
33223418
- test-rapid-sharded_cluster
3419+
- test-7.0-server
3420+
- test-7.0-replica_set
3421+
- test-7.0-sharded_cluster
33233422
- test-6.0-server
33243423
- test-6.0-replica_set
33253424
- test-6.0-sharded_cluster
@@ -3361,6 +3460,9 @@ buildvariants:
33613460
- test-rapid-server
33623461
- test-rapid-replica_set
33633462
- test-rapid-sharded_cluster
3463+
- test-7.0-server
3464+
- test-7.0-replica_set
3465+
- test-7.0-sharded_cluster
33643466
- test-6.0-server
33653467
- test-6.0-replica_set
33663468
- test-6.0-sharded_cluster
@@ -3400,6 +3502,9 @@ buildvariants:
34003502
- test-rapid-server
34013503
- test-rapid-replica_set
34023504
- test-rapid-sharded_cluster
3505+
- test-7.0-server
3506+
- test-7.0-replica_set
3507+
- test-7.0-sharded_cluster
34033508
- test-6.0-server
34043509
- test-6.0-replica_set
34053510
- test-6.0-sharded_cluster
@@ -3607,6 +3712,9 @@ buildvariants:
36073712
- test-rapid-server-noauth
36083713
- test-rapid-replica_set-noauth
36093714
- test-rapid-sharded_cluster-noauth
3715+
- test-7.0-server-noauth
3716+
- test-7.0-replica_set-noauth
3717+
- test-7.0-sharded_cluster-noauth
36103718
- test-6.0-server-noauth
36113719
- test-6.0-replica_set-noauth
36123720
- test-6.0-sharded_cluster-noauth

0 commit comments

Comments
 (0)